Definitions
American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, Fourth Edition
- adj. Of or relating to Nubia or its peoples, languages, or cultures.
- n. A native or inhabitant of Nubia.
- n. Any of a group of closely related Nilo-Saharan languages spoken in the Sudan. Also called Nuba.
Century Dictionary and Cyclopedia
- Of or pertaining to Nubia, a region of Africa, bordering on the Red Sea, and south of Egypt proper. The name is merely geographical, Nubia never having existed as a distinct country.
- n. One of a race inhabiting Nubia, of mixed descent.
- n. In the Nile valley, a negro slave: from the large number of slaves at one time brought from Nubia.
Wiktionary
- n. An inhabitant of the ancient Nubia or a person of Nubian descent.
- adj. Pertaining to Nubia, its people or its language.
GNU Webster's 1913
- adj. Of or pertaining to Nubia in Eastern Africa.
WordNet 3.0
- n. a native or inhabitant of Nubia
